Director of Residences

Summary of Position

The Director of Residences oversees the management and operations of our luxury residential units. The ideal candidate will have a strong background in residential management within a luxury hotel or high-end residential environment, demonstrating exceptional leadership, customer service, and operational skills.

Roles and Responsibilities

  1. Oversee the daily operations of the residences, ensuring the highest standards of service, maintenance, and overall resident satisfaction.
  2. Develop and implement operational policies and procedures that enhance the residential experience.
  3. Coordinate with the hotel's management team to ensure seamless integration of services and amenities for residents.
  4. Establish and maintain strong relationships with residents, addressing their needs and concerns promptly and effectively.
  5. Organize and manage resident events, activities, and services that enhance the community atmosphere.
  6. Serve as the primary point of contact for residents, ensuring a personalized and attentive experience.
  7. Develop and manage the residences' budget, including forecasting, expense control, and financial reporting.
  8. Oversee billing and collection processes, ensuring accuracy and timeliness.
  9. Implement cost-effective measures without compromising service quality.
  10. Lead, motivate, and manage the residential team, including hiring, training, and performance evaluations.
  11. Foster a positive and collaborative work environment that promotes professional growth and high standards of service.
  12. Coordinate with various departments to ensure smooth operations and effective communication.
  13. Ensure the residences are maintained to the highest standards, coordinating with maintenance and housekeeping teams.
  14. Conduct regular inspections and address any maintenance issues promptly.
  15. Implement and oversee preventive maintenance programs.
  16. Ensure compliance with all legal, safety, and regulatory requirements.
  17. Develop and implement safety and emergency procedures.
  18. Stay informed of industry trends and best practices to continuously improve operations.
